Output 24909dd9e51cbbfc5f644df061b5a0828f7352054cdb105a5bd7e7aa86175d0b:2

value
54769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d340cc3be6352286d8f2ea385b3a582d7fe67c OP_EQUAL
address
3LuktxAkemLgot97QWbVgYZniBE7ewKT1Q
transaction
24909dd9e51cbbfc5f644df061b5a0828f7352054cdb105a5bd7e7aa86175d0b
confirmations
90007
spent
true